The , also known as Mughal Eidgah, is located in Saat Masjid road, in Dhanmondi residential area of , Bangladesh. The Eidgah was built in 1640 CE during the Mughal era and has been in use for Eid celebration since then. is situated 2 km north of Hazaribagh Park.

Central includes Motijheel, the centre of finance and business, the University of Dhaka, a historic area with a number of museums, and Tejgaon-Dhanmondi, home to large shopping malls, markets and a variety of eateries.
